Title:
CELLULOSE ETHER DERIVATIVE FINE PARTICLES
Document Type and Number:
WIPO Patent Application WO/2017/073626
Kind Code:
A1
Abstract:
Provided are cellulose ether derivative fine particles that have an average particle size of 1-1000 μm, a linseed oil absorption of 50-1000 mL/100 g, and an average surface pore size of 0.05-5 μm, and that are obtained by mixing a cellulose ether derivative (A), a polymer (B) that is not a cellulose ether derivative, and an alcohol solvent (C), phase-separating the mixture into two phases which are a solution phase containing the cellulose ether derivative (A) as the main component and a solution phase containing the polymer (B) as the main component, forming an emulsion in a system in which the solvents of the two phases obtained by the phase separation are substantially the same, and thereafter, bringing the emulsion into contact with a poor solvent (D).
